**Vendor note: Inkmill markdown pipeline**

Rendering for Parchway docs is outsourced to Inkmill under an annual contract, renewing each March. They handle sanitization and PDF export; we own the upload queue. SLA: 4-hour response on rendering failures. Escalate only after two failed retries. Their support desk is reachable at the address below.

billing contact of hahaf-baguf = zorael.tammir.jorius@sivrelhq.internal

Subject: LiftLogic sim build is out

Hey all — welcome aboard to our new contractor! We just cut a fresh build of the Marplewick elevator-dispatch simulator. Main changes: saner peak-hour queuing and a fix for cars ghosting on floor twelve. Grab it from the usual release share and poke around before Thursday's review. The build is tagged with the identifier below.

pipeline stamp: htk9_ce63042d9

### Step 4: Move per-tenant quotas to QuotaSmith

Okay, this is the fiddly part. We're retiring the old hardcoded rate limits in Ledgewick's gateway and moving every tenant onto QuotaSmith's per-tenant quota service. Heads up for security review: quotas are now enforced before auth caching, so a misconfigured tenant can't burn shared capacity. Double-check that burst multipliers and the default deny behavior match what we agreed on in the threat model. The new quota service's configuration values are shown below.

service settings:
novath:
  pin: 1396
  tenant: pelys
  seal: seal_ccc035e1
  metrics_host: metrics.novath.qorvelworks.test
  standby_team: fraeth
  escalation: drueth-zorok
  nonce: 61d508

# Why these numbers exist (cron drift saga)
#
# Plugin authors: last quarter we chased a fun bug where scheduled
# jobs in Pellmont drifted several seconds per hour because each
# plugin computed its own next-run time. We now centralize the
# schedule math and clamp drift at the host. Please don't roll your
# own timers; read these constants instead, shown below.

tuning table, faweg-bajep:
WEIGHTS = {
    "belius": 690,
    "eliox": 458,
    "norax": 616,
    "praion": 132,
    "zorvan": 911,
}